Kerala Assembly session likely to be stormy
Thiruvananthapuram, Nov 23 (UNI) The Kerala Assembly Session beginning tomorrow, is likely to be stormy, as the Congress-led opposition United Democratic Front (UDF) is ready to take on the government on various issues including the alleged misuse of the Central funds and delay in the much-hyped Rs 15 billion-Smart City IT project in Kochi.
The session, convened to pass more than 20 Bills, would mainly be dicussing political issues.
